BMI Calculator for Children and Teens

Body Mass Index ( BMI) is a way of estimating the body's fat content that includes the individual's height. BMI is calculated by analyzing the person's weight and height. For teens and children, BMI is used to figure the extent to which a child teenager is at an appropriate weight, overweight, or obese. The amount of fat a child's body has changes with age. Additionally, boys and girls differ in the amount of body fat when they get older. This is why BMI for children, also known as BMI-for-age includes gender and age.

This calculator estimates an estimation of BMI for children between the ages of 5-18. It will inform you if a child is underweight in a normal weight, is at risk of becoming overweight, or is now overweight.

Body Mass Index, or BMI is a vital measure of the person's height and weight. It's the weight of a person in kilograms divided by the square root of his/her size in meters. It is the National Institute of Health (NIH) has now established BMI to be the most important factor to determine if you are underweight, normal weight, overweight or obese. So, knowing your BMI is a vital aspect in maintaining the health of your body and optimum fitness level. A healthy BMI will also help combat heart disease such as type 2 diabetes as well as hypertension in check. A normal BMI is an indicator of being in the ideal weight range. BMI is essentially a quantifiable measurement of the tissue mass, also known as bone, fat, and muscles of an individual.

However, if you are an athlete or physical activity person, you weight might be excessive in no way due to fat but due to muscles. Muscle is more dense than fat. The greater density of muscle can mean more weight , which translates into more BMI. In such a scenario, it is not unhealthy because it doesn't have the health risks that the high BMI reads.

  3. What is the reason why BMI calculation important for your health?
    The National Institute of Health (NIH) has now established BMI as the most important measure to determine whether you are underweight, normal weight and overweight or obese. If you are not within the category of normal weight, your health is at risk. Let's say that your BMI of 17.5. This means that you are underweight. Being underweight makes you more prone to diseases because it signifies that your body's immunity may be weak. You can even get osteoporosis later in life or be anaemic. However, if you are overweight, obese or severely obese, your chances to develop various illnesses rise as you increase the BMI number. The risk increases for diseases such as high blood pressure, type 2 diabetes, high cholesterol, heart disease and stroke among others.
